RM2DDEP3A–Barbed wire acts as one of barriers used by the Khmer Rouge in what is now the Tuol Sleng Genocide Museum in Phnom Penh, Cambodia. Once a secondary school, Tuol Sway Pray High School, from 1976-1979 it became Security Prison 21 (S-21). Composed of several buildings, the campus became an internment camp where an estimated 20,000 persons were imprisoned, tortured, and died. Enclosed in electrified barbed wire, the former school was uncovered by the conquering Vietnamese Army. Out of the over 20,000 prisoners, there were 12 known survivors. The school is now the Tuol Sleng Genocide Museum.

RMT950PW–Charles Blondin (born Jean François Gravelet, February 28, 1824 - February 22, 1897) was a French tightrope walker and acrobat, called the 'Chevalier Blondin', or simply 'The Great Blondin'. At the age of five he was sent to the École de Gymnase at Lyon and, after six months training as an acrobat, made his first public appearance as 'The Boy Wonder'. His superior skill and grace, as well as the originality of the settings of his acts, made him a popular favorite.

It will be seen that the current flows in the external circuitthrough the voltmeter from the positive or high-pressure endB to the negative or low-pressure end A of the wire ; and withinthe moving wire the current flows from the low-pressure end tothe high-pressure end. The motion of the wire across the linesof force causes it to act like a pump which lifts the electriccurrent from its low-pressure or suction end to its high-pressureor discharge end.
